Output 39ab4efb010de99de692f1a32550fa3d6257226dfbd2ad4e7b0d422e82e21de8:1

value
3050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fcc3d44d5d5e3ce7cdd7c383aab844f42d669e1 OP_EQUAL
address
3DLkQhmhD6TyG6qJNZDJXSu99juzbFnaRg
transaction
39ab4efb010de99de692f1a32550fa3d6257226dfbd2ad4e7b0d422e82e21de8
confirmations
510768
spent
true